Toyo Tires Columbus IN
Add Website
Close
Toyo Tires
Be first to review 2235 25th St,Columbus IN 47203 Phone Number: (812) 372-0245
Toyo Tires Store Hours
Hours may fluctuate
Post a review
Toyo Tires Nearby
Locations Closest to You miles-
Toyo Tires - Columbus 1390 N NATIONAL ROAD0.97
-
Toyo Tires - Greensburg 220 W. MAIN STREET23.07
-
Toyo Tires - Indianapolis 8145 US 31 SOUTH32.14